Confidential Bioprocessing Facility FEL3

Isomer completed a FEL3 front-end engineering design for a proprietary bioprocessing facility ($50MM+ TIC) to utilize specially engineered microorganisms to synthesize bio-based chemicals and produce sustainable commodity products using renewable raw materials, like sugar. Isomer created process models for multiple bio-based chemicals, each containing several process unit operations such as fermentation and DSP (downstream processing; sterilization, filtration, chromatography, precipitation, extraction, and crystallization). The new process was integrated into an existing manufacturing facility, which required significant brownfield modifications to existing infrastructure and utility systems. Isomer aggressively expedited the delivery of the comprehensive FEED package to support applications for federal funding, completing the work in less than six months.
